Local Roofing Challenges in Tustin

Tustin’s climate is defined by intense central OC sun and the occasional influence of the Santa Ana winds.

  • Intense Thermal Cycling: Tustin regularly sees high daytime temperatures. The transition from 90-degree days to cool evening breezes causes significant stress on roofing seals as materials expand and contract rapidly each day.
  • Wind and Organic Debris: Tustin’s beautiful mature trees drop significant amounts of leaves, bark, and needles. During wind events, this debris can be driven under shingles or clog drainage systems, causing “backup leaks” that can damage your interior ceilings.

5-Point Roofing Checklist for Tustin Homeowners

  1. Check for “Granule Shedding”: Inspect your gutters for stone granules, which indicates the sun is reaching the waterproof core of your shingles.
  2. Clear Tree Limb Clearance: Ensure no branches are touching your roof, as Tustin’s afternoon breezes can cause abrasive damage over time.
  3. Verify Attic Cooling: Effective airflow is critical to prevent the “baking” effect that destroys shingles from the bottom up in our hot summers.
  4. Monitor for “Tile Slide”: On Mediterranean-style homes in Tustin Ranch, ensures that heavy tiles haven’t shifted and exposed the sensitive underlayment.
  5. Inspect Gutter Alignment: Ensure your drainage is clear of debris from our namesake trees so they can handle seasonal OC rainstorms without overflowing.

Expert Local Tips for Tustin

  • Tustin's namesake trees drop heavy organic debris; we recommend installing high-grade stainless steel gutter screens to prevent the 'wicking' rot common in older Tustin eaves.
  • For Tustin Ranch homes with steep concrete tile roofs, we advise checking 'mortal' or adhesive pads every 5 years, as OC's heat and subtle tremors can cause tile-slip.
  • The 'Marine Layer' in central OC often lingers; if your roof is north-facing, choosing an 'Algae-Resistant' shingle will prevent the black streaks that diminish curb appeal.
  • Historical homes in Old Town often have older wood roof decks; always insist on a full 'sheathing inspection' during a repair to catch soft spots before they become major leaks.
